    Gamergirl, you can definitely write about your experiences with your puppy, right?  I know what you mean about the google thing.  If I do online research for a topic, it is something I at least have a basic interest/knowledge of.
    For the football topic, my dad gave me tons of ideas...but it meant quickly studying up on something I didn't know about or care to learn.  So, I tried to figure out how football relates to my interests...let's see...football...football in movies...I like movies.  Hm, are there any funny football movies?
    Same thing with the China topic.  Some of my favorite games as a child were the Chinese jump rope, Chinese checkers (which aren't really from China), and the Chinese fingertrap.  So, I could at least draw from personal experience and memory, somewhat, and then do a bit of research to round off the edges.
    However, I wouldn't feel at all comfortable writing about ancient Chinese art because...I know nothing about it!  It would be too weird to quickly read up on it and regurgitate a bunch of stuff.
